Transaction 683249c154b149f2196f1d2946c1a114fab8a9d6edd692ed06aa948ebdf4a86f

1 Input
2 Outputs
  • 683249c154b149f2196f1d2946c1a114fab8a9d6edd692ed06aa948ebdf4a86f:0
  • value  3389325
    address  3PULwGBnf1qehpAChLeZWPeW4ZhpXAkK8J
  • 683249c154b149f2196f1d2946c1a114fab8a9d6edd692ed06aa948ebdf4a86f:1
  • value  105657601
    address  1UsEvxLjA8DVDmjzkB8QiGCFQPx39QrM8